Variant summary

Our verdict is Uncertain significance. Variant got 3 ACMG points: 3P and 0B. PM2PP3

The NM_001130083.2(ABLIM2):c.1366C>G(p.Pro456Ala) variant causes a missense change involving the alteration of a con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
ABLIM2 (HGNC:19195): (actin binding LIM protein family member 2) Predicted to enable actin filament binding activity. Predicted to be involved in lamellipodium assembly. Predicted to act upstream of or within positive regulation of transcription by RNA polymerase II. Located in actin cytoskeleton. [provided by Alliance of Genome Resources, Apr 2022]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sAug 02, 2021The c.1366C>G (p.P456A) alteration is located in exon 13 (coding exon 13) of the ABLIM2 gene. This alteration results from a C to G substitution at nucleotide position 1366, causing the proline (P) at amino acid position 456 to be replaced by an alanine (A).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
